The Biggest Pros and Cons
The 1981 Baba 30 cutter is a classic cruising sailboat known for its sturdy construction and comfortable design. Here are some of the pros and cons to consider:
Pros
Solid Build Quality: The Baba 30 is renowned for its robust fiberglass hull and heavy-duty construction, providing excellent durability and safety for offshore cruising.
Seaworthy Design: With a full keel and cutter rig, it offers great stability and good handling in various sea conditions, making it a reliable choice for long-distance voyaging.
Spacious Interior: Despite its 30-foot length, the layout maximizes living space, featuring a comfortable saloon, functional galley, and ample storage for extended trips.
Classic Aesthetics: The traditional lines and teak wood finishes give the Baba 30 a timeless appeal that many sailors appreciate.
Proven Offshore Performance: Many Baba 30s have completed extensive passages, proving their capability and resilience.
Cons
Heavier Weight: The solid construction results in a heavier boat, which can affect speed and responsiveness compared to lighter, more modern designs.
Limited Maneuverability: The full keel and cutter rig, while stable, may make tight marina maneuvers more challenging without experience.
Aging Systems: Being a 1981 model, electrical, plumbing, and mechanical systems may require updating or maintenance to meet current standards.
Smaller Size: While well-designed, the 30-foot length means less overall space compared to larger cruisers, which might be a consideration for extended liveaboard comfort.
Limited Performance in Light Winds: The heavier displacement and traditional sail plan can result in slower speeds when wind conditions are light.
